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/316.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 是否可以在远程服务器上运行MSTest而不安装VS2013或VS2015?_C#_Visual Studio_Selenium_Automation_Mstest - Fatal编程技术网

C# 是否可以在远程服务器上运行MSTest而不安装VS2013或VS2015?

C# 是否可以在远程服务器上运行MSTest而不安装VS2013或VS2015?,c#,visual-studio,selenium,automation,mstest,C#,Visual Studio,Selenium,Automation,Mstest,我有一个由C#和Selenium编写的自动化测试项目。我只想让MSTest在远程服务器上运行它,这样我就可以将它与我的CI服务器集成,并在每次提交新更改后运行它。我没有使用TFS,我不想在服务器上安装VS,因为内存消耗很大。只是想知道是否有一种方法可以通过将所有与MSTest相关的文件复制到服务器而不是安装VS来让MSTest工作 我在谷歌上尝试了一些解决方案。它们都不起作用。可能是VS2012或更低版本的设置,但我尝试了VS2013和VS2015。错误消息是“异常已被调用的目标抛出”。不知道是

我有一个由C#和Selenium编写的自动化测试项目。我只想让MSTest在远程服务器上运行它,这样我就可以将它与我的CI服务器集成,并在每次提交新更改后运行它。我没有使用TFS,我不想在服务器上安装VS,因为内存消耗很大。只是想知道是否有一种方法可以通过将所有与MSTest相关的文件复制到服务器而不是安装VS来让MSTest工作

我在谷歌上尝试了一些解决方案。它们都不起作用。可能是VS2012或更低版本的设置,但我尝试了VS2013和VS2015。错误消息是“异常已被调用的目标抛出”。不知道是我的项目问题还是MSTest缺少文件


感谢您的帮助

据我所知,没有。正如你提到的那样,我试着按照别人的步骤做,但没有一个成功。我总是安装测试框架。

据我所知不是这样。正如你提到的那样,我试着按照别人的步骤做,但没有一个成功。我总是安装测试框架。

你试过了吗?是的。我已经试过了。这就是我收到错误信息的地方。你试过了吗?是的。我已经试过了。这就是我得到错误信息的地方。你说安装测试框架是什么意思?你是说安装VisualStudio吗?我使用的是Visual Studio单元测试框架。没有可靠的方法可以避免从Visual Studio安装二进制文件。以下链接提供了要安装的代理下载链接。是 啊我以前已经签出了这个链接。代理仍然需要相当大的磁盘空间。我犹豫是否要安装它,所以我来这里看看是否有更好的解决方案。现在我可以继续安装它了。谢谢你的帮助!安装测试框架是什么意思?你是说安装VisualStudio吗?我使用的是Visual Studio单元测试框架。没有可靠的方法可以避免从Visual Studio安装二进制文件。以下链接提供了要安装的代理下载链接。是 啊我以前已经签出了这个链接。代理仍然需要相当大的磁盘空间。我犹豫是否要安装它,所以我来这里看看是否有更好的解决方案。现在我可以继续安装它了。谢谢你的帮助!